Allan Melvin was an American character actor who left a lasting impact on television through his memorable performances in various iconic shows. Born on February 18, 1923 in Kansas City, Missouri, Melvin had a natural talent for entertainment that would eventually lead him to a successful career in both theatre and television.
Before becoming a household name in the world of television, Allan Melvin first made a name for himself in the entertainment industry through his victory in the prestigious Arthur Godfrey's Talent Scouts radio competition. This win opened doors for Melvin, paving the way for a career in theatre that would set the stage for his future success on television.
One of Allan Melvin's most notable roles was that of Corporal Henshaw on the beloved sitcom The Phil Silvers Show. His portrayal of the lovable character endeared him to audiences and solidified his place in the world of television. Melvin's talent for bringing characters to life on screen was further showcased in his role as Sam the butcher on The Brady Bunch and as Barney Hefner on All in the Family.
Aside from his work on television, Allan Melvin also lent his talents to various television commercials, becoming a familiar face to audiences through his endorsements of products such as Frosted Flakes, Remington electric razors, and Liquid-Plumr. Behind the scenes, Allan Melvin shared his life with his beloved wife Amalia Faustina Sestero, whom he married in 1944. Their union stood the test of time, enduring until Melvin's passing.
